13056043152 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of eighty divisors.
Prime factorization of 13056043152:
24 × 3 × 139 × 317 × 6173
(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 139 × 317 × 6173)See below for interesting mathematical facts about the number 13056043152 from the Numbermatics database.

-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 34083443520
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 21027400368
- 13056043152 is an abundant number, because the sum of its proper divisors (21027400368) is greater than itself. Its abundance is 7971357216

To count from 1 to 13,056,043,152 would take you about eight hundred thirty years!
This is a very rough estimate, based on a speaking rate of half a second every third order of magnitude. If you speak quickly, you could probably say any randomly-chosen number between one and a thousand in around half a second. Very big numbers obviously take longer to say, so we add half a second for every extra x1000. (We do not count involuntary pauses, bathroom breaks or the necessity of sleep in our calculation!)
